Relax Cafeteria

Muharraq,
Relax Cafeteria Relax Cafeteria is one of the popular Local Business located in ,Muharraq listed under Local business in Muharraq , Cafeteria in Muharraq ,

Contact Details & Working Hours

Map of Relax Cafeteria